Wouldn’t life be so much easier if we could wear the same exact thing every day? I don’t mean in the sense of a uniform, I’m talking physically wearing the same exact garments every day. From a hygiene standpoint, it’s not exactly sanitary to wear the same clothes every day. From a fashion standpoint, most people see this as a serious faux pas. Here are two items you most definitely should wear with at least a day in between.

Bras: I’m not sure if women know this or not, but you shouldn’t wear the same bra day after day. Bras need at least one day in between to rest, so to speak. After wearing a bra all day long, the elastic is stretched out so it needs time to recover and get back into place. If you wear the same bra every day, the elastic will never get a chance to tighten back up so you’ll stretch it out pretty fast. Alternate different bras each day or invest in multiple bras to wear them every few days.

Shoes: There are tons and tons of people out there who own one pair of shoes and wear them into the ground. However, it’s best if you don’t wear the same pair of shoes every day. Much like bras, shoes need time to recover and so do your feet! By wearing the same pair or same style of shoes every day, you’re putting “repeated pressure on identical areas of the foot” according to Jaleh Hoofar, doctor of podiatric medicine.
